The Limitations of Metaphysical Interpretations
While metaphysical interpretations offer valuable insights into the spiritual meanings of dental issues, it is essential to acknowledge their limitations. Metaphysical frameworks provide a starting point for exploration and questioning, rather than serving as definitive answers to complex matters.
It is crucial to approach healing stories derived from metaphysical meanings with caution. While these stories can be inspiring and thought-provoking, it is essential to ensure they are supported by evidence and not used to make unsubstantiated claims.
Metaphysical interpretations have their strengths in providing a broader perspective and offering a holistic approach to dental health. They can help individuals understand the deeper emotional, mental, and spiritual aspects that may contribute to dental issues. However, it is important to combine metaphysical insights with scientific understanding and professional dental care for comprehensive oral health.
“Metaphysical interpretations offer valuable insights but should not be the sole basis for decision-making or treatment. It is important to critically evaluate information and consider multiple perspectives to make informed choices.”
When engaging with metaphysical interpretations, it is vital to maintain an open mind and view them as complementary to other sources of knowledge. By integrating the strengths of metaphysical meanings with evidence-based practices, individuals can cultivate a well-rounded approach to their dental health.
